Sheboygan police look for suspect in fatal shooting

SHEBOYGAN, WI (WTAQ) - Sheboygan police are searching for a “known suspect” in the shooting death of a 24-year-old man on Saturday  Police were called to the St. Nichols Hospital around 7 p.m. for a report of a man who had been shot.  Authorities were told that others had taken the man to the hospital after finding him in the 1800 block of South 9th St.  The victim was then airlifted to Froedtert Hospital in Wauwatosa where he later died.  Capt. James Veeser says the shooting was not a random act and they are looking for a “known suspect”.  Fox 11 WLUK-TV reports that neighbors and witnesses gathered outside a home where the shooting took place say the victim and shooter are brothers.  Police however have not confirmed those details. Another witness says the victim is believed to be a father of four with a fifth child on the way.
